Subject: Re: [PATCH 35/46] xfs: cleanup __xfs_dir3_data_check

On Thu, Nov 07, 2019 at 07:23:59PM +0100, Christoph Hellwig wrote:
> Use an offset as the main means for iteration, and only do pointer
> arithmetics to find the data/unused entries.
>
>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
Looks ok,
Reviewed-by: Darrick J. Wong <darrick.wong@oracle.com>
--D
> ---
> f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_dir2_data.c | 59 ++++++++++++++++++++---------------
> 1 file changed, 33 insertions(+), 26 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_dir2_data.c b/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_dir2_data.c
> index 50e3fa092ff9..8c729270f9f1 100644
> --- a/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_dir2_data.c
> +++ b/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_dir2_data.c
> @@ -23,6 +23,22 @@ static xfs_failaddr_t xfs_dir2_data_freefind_verify(
> struct xfs_dir2_data_unused *dup,
> struct xfs_dir2_data_free **bf_ent);
>
> +/*
> + * The number of leaf entries is limited by the size of the block and the amount
> + * of space used by the data entries. We don't know how much space is used by
> + * the data entries yet, so just ensure that the count falls somewhere inside
> + * the block right now.
> + */
> +static inline unsigned int
> +xfs_dir2_data_max_leaf_entries(
> + const struct xfs_dir_ops *ops,
> + struct xfs_da_geometry *geo)
> +{
> + return (geo->blksize - sizeof(struct xfs_dir2_block_tail) -
> + ops->data_entry_offset) /
> + sizeof(struct xfs_dir2_leaf_entry);
> +}
> +
> /*
> * Check the consistency of the data block.
> * The input can also be a block-format directory.
> @@ -38,23 +54,20 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> xfs_dir2_block_tail_t *btp=NULL; /* block tail */
> int count; /* count of entries found */
> xfs_dir2_data_hdr_t *hdr; /* data block header */
> - xfs_dir2_data_entry_t *dep; /* data entry */
> xfs_dir2_data_free_t *dfp; /* bestfree entry */
> - xfs_dir2_data_unused_t *dup; /* unused entry */
> - char *endp; /* end of useful data */
> + void *endp; /* end of useful data */
> int freeseen; /* mask of bestfrees seen */
> xfs_dahash_t hash; /* hash of current name */
> int i; /* leaf index */
> int lastfree; /* last entry was unused */
> xfs_dir2_leaf_entry_t *lep=NULL; /* block leaf entries */
> struct xfs_mount *mp = bp->b_mount;
> - char *p; /* current data position */
> int stale; /* count of stale leaves */
> struct xfs_name name;
> + unsigned int offset;
> + unsigned int end;
> const struct xfs_dir_ops *ops;
> - struct xfs_da_geometry *geo;
> -
> - geo = mp->m_dir_geo;
> + struct xfs_da_geometry *geo = mp->m_dir_geo;
>
> /*
> * We can be passed a null dp here from a verifier, so we need to go the
> @@ -71,7 +84,7 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> return __this_address;
>
> hdr = bp->b_addr;
> - p = (char *)ops->data_entry_p(hdr);
> + offset = ops->data_entry_offset;
>
> switch (hdr->magic) {
> case cpu_to_be32(XFS_DIR3_BLOCK_MAGIC):
> @@ -79,15 +92,8 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> btp = xfs_dir2_block_tail_p(geo, hdr);
> lep = xfs_dir2_block_leaf_p(btp);
>
> - /*
> - * The number of leaf entries is limited by the size of the
> - * block and the amount of space used by the data entries.
> - * We don't know how much space is used by the data entries yet,
> - * so just ensure that the count falls somewhere inside the
> - * block right now.
> - */
> if (be32_to_cpu(btp->count) >=
> - ((char *)btp - p) / sizeof(struct xfs_dir2_leaf_entry))
> + xfs_dir2_data_max_leaf_entries(ops, geo))
> return __this_address;
> break;
> case cpu_to_be32(XFS_DIR3_DATA_MAGIC):
> @@ -99,6 +105,7 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> endp = xfs_dir3_data_endp(geo, hdr);
> if (!endp)
> return __this_address;
> + end = endp - bp->b_addr;
>
> /*
> * Account for zero bestfree entries.
> @@ -128,8 +135,10 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> /*
> * Loop over the data/unused entries.
> */
> - while (p < endp) {
> - dup = (xfs_dir2_data_unused_t *)p;
> + while (offset < end) {
> + struct xfs_dir2_data_unused *dup = bp->b_addr + offset;
> + struct xfs_dir2_data_entry *dep = bp->b_addr + offset;
> +
> /*
> * If it's unused, look for the space in the bestfree table.
> * If we find it, account for that, else make sure it
> @@ -140,10 +149,10 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
>
> if (lastfree != 0)
> return __this_address;
> - if (endp < p + be16_to_cpu(dup->length))
> + if (offset + be16_to_cpu(dup->length) > end)
> return __this_address;
> if (be16_to_cpu(*xfs_dir2_data_unused_tag_p(dup)) !=
> - (char *)dup - (char *)hdr)
> + offset)
> return __this_address;
> fa = xfs_dir2_data_freefind_verify(hdr, bf, dup, &dfp);
> if (fa)
> @@ -158,7 +167,7 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> be16_to_cpu(bf[2].length))
> return __this_address;
> }
> - p += be16_to_cpu(dup->length);
> + offset += be16_to_cpu(dup->length);
> lastfree = 1;
> continue;
> }
> @@ -168,15 +177,13 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> * in the leaf section of the block.
> * The linear search is crude but this is DEBUG code.
> */
> - dep = (xfs_dir2_data_entry_t *)p;
> if (dep->namelen == 0)
> return __this_address;
> if (xfs_dir_ino_validate(mp, be64_to_cpu(dep->inumber)))
> return __this_address;
> - if (endp < p + ops->data_entsize(dep->namelen))
> + if (offset + ops->data_entsize(dep->namelen) > end)
> return __this_address;
> - if (be16_to_cpu(*ops->data_entry_tag_p(dep)) !=
> - (char *)dep - (char *)hdr)
> + if (be16_to_cpu(*ops->data_entry_tag_p(dep)) != offset)
> return __this_address;
> if (ops->data_get_ftype(dep) >= XFS_DIR3_FT_MAX)
> return __this_address;
> @@ -198,7 +205,7 @@ __xfs_dir3_data_check(
> if (i >= be32_to_cpu(btp->count))
> return __this_address;
> }
> - p += ops->data_entsize(dep->namelen);
> + offset += ops->data_entsize(dep->namelen);
> }
> /*
> * Need to have seen all the entries and all the bestfree slots.
> --
> 2.20.1
